Eligible candidates must register online through the official APSCHE portal for the Spot Round. Registration involves entering your APEdCET hall ticket number, rank, and personal details. Completing this step within the specified dates is mandatory to participate in seat allotment for the Spot Round.

Candidates who have qualified in the APEdCET 2025 exam but were not allotted a seat in the first or subsequent counselling rounds are eligible. Additionally, candidates who wish to surrender their previous seat and seek admission in another college can also participate. Eligibility is strictly based on rank and availability of seats.

The Andhra Pradesh EdCET 2025 Spot Round is an additional counselling phase conducted for candidates who either did not get a seat in the earlier counselling phases or wish to change their allotted college. This round allows eligible candidates to secure available seats in BEd and BEd Special Education programs across Andhra Pradesh through a streamlined online process.

The first phase of seat allotment is scheduled for 18 September 2025. Candidates must check their allotment status online and complete self-reporting and college reporting between 19 and 20 September 2025. Admission is confirmed only after completing these steps, following which classes commence on 19 September 2025.
